Primary Immunodeficiency Diseases
Primary immunodeficiency diseases are genetic disorders that affect the development or function of the immune system. These conditions are typically present from birth and can result in a range of symptoms, including recurrent infections, autoimmune disorders, and allergies. Examples of primary immunodeficiency diseases include severe combined immunodeficiency (SCID), common variable immunodeficiency (CVID), and X-linked agammaglobulinemia.
Secondary Immunodeficiency Diseases
Secondary immunodeficiency diseases are acquired conditions that weaken the immune system. These conditions can be caused by a variety of factors, including infections, medications, and other health conditions. Examples of secondary immunodeficiency diseases include HIV/AIDS, cancer, and certain autoimmune diseases.

Treatment Options
Treatment for immunodeficiency diseases varies depending on the underlying cause and severity of the condition. In some cases, medications, such as antibiotics or antiviral drugs, may be prescribed to help prevent or treat infections. In other cases, immunoglobulin replacement therapy may be necessary to supplement the immune system. In severe cases, a bone marrow or stem cell transplant may be necessary to replace the damaged or missing cells of the immune system.
